PROCESS FOR TREATING HIGH MAGNESIUM NICKELIFEROUS LATERITES AND GARNIERITES

1445059 Leaching nickel-bearing ores SHERRITT GORDON MINES Ltd 18 June 1974 [11 July 1973] 26855/74 Heading C1A The proportion of nickel extracted is substantially increased in the process in which nickeliferous lateric and garnieritic ore particles containing more than 5% Mg are treated to reduce the nickel to metallic form and the reduced particles are quenched in an aqueous ammoniacal (NH 4 ) 2 CO 3 solution then leached in a like solution in the presence of free oxygen to extract the nickel, by subjecting the quenched particles to attrition in order to rub off an outer layer therefrom and to expose underlying surfaces to penetration by the leach solution. Sulphur-containing material may be added prior to roasting and the quenched particles may be soaked in the absence of oxygen for more than three hours before and/or after attrition.
